Early research was designed primarily to evaluate the safety of the stem cells and the technique used to implant them in the brain.

WebApr 14, 2024 · Although hundreds of studies in animals — and a handful in humans — have demonstrated that stem cells transplanted into the brain can improve stroke outcomes, the challenge has been finding the best way to deliver and use the cells.
